Here's a few photos of my humble living room setup, constructed on a fairly restricted budget.. Like all AV setups its a work in progress but im quite happy with it as it is for the foreseeable future. I live in a flat with neighbours above, below and through the wall so all things considered it sounds really good

SONY KDL 40ex503 LCD TV
SONY STR DH810 AV RECEIVER
SONY BDP S370 BLU RAY PLAYER
TANNOY MERCURY V1 FRONTS AND VC CENTRE SPEAKERS
TANNOY SFX SURROUNDS
TANNOY SFX FRONT HEIGHTS
TANNOY SFX SUB
XBOX 360
VIRGIN MEDIA TIVO BOX
PACKARD BELL HTPC
DIY AMBILIGHT USING ARDUINO MEGA MICRO CONTROLLER

Really nice setup. Out of interest, how does the ambilight work, assume its connected to the HTPC.
 
PKtheDJ said:
Really nice setup. Out of interest, how does the ambilight work, assume its connected to the HTPC.

Cheers mate, aye it works through the PC through a free software called Amblone.. There is 3 RGB led lights strips stuck to the back of the TV each one soldered onto an Arduino Mega micro controller and the Arduino is connected to the PC with a USB.. You can use it as a static mood light also if you don't want the ambilight effect on
